Output 60503738194a11156da0121db4fc0af50786b94470d1b1f8d00b0343e1bfdf39:1

value
24752132
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f29b3f054077217388e802a62bf21c32b0fa60a OP_EQUAL
address
3ANC5LP2itydJ4EsujQAED6MkYLpDtvhSs
transaction
60503738194a11156da0121db4fc0af50786b94470d1b1f8d00b0343e1bfdf39
spent
true